Local House panel will hold hearing into Cheney’s role in Oregon salmon die-off
June 28th, 2007 | by jeff | | Post to NewsCloud »In light of allegations made about Cheney’s role in developing a 10-year water plan for the Klamath River that courts later called arbitrary and in violation of the Endangered Species Act, a hearing is worthwhile, Rahall said. He and other Democrats charged that Cheney’s action resulted in the largest adult salmon kill in the history of the West.
